# Restocker env — read before touching anything!
# This configures the SnackPilot restock planner that on-call babysits.
# ROUTE_WINDOW_HOURS controls how far ahead we plan truck routes (keep it at 48
# unless the Delmora depot asks otherwise). DRY_RUN=1 is your friend when testing.
# The planner can't talk to the inventory feed without its credential, so the
# next line sets that.

vault entry, kafog-yahop: COURIER_KEY8=0faa53ae

## Health Checks Behind the Balancer

The Lanternfall API sits behind our Plover load balancer, which probes /healthz every 10s. The handler must verify a live database round-trip, not just return 200. When reviewing changes to the probe logic, test locally against the staging database using the connection string below.

primary connection of yagep-kahip = redis://giliel_svc:zYiKsLL2PLpfPL@db-348f.xolmarsys.corp:5432/fenwyn

## Who to Contact: GridSheet Export Memory Issues

If a customer reports that Tallyform's GridSheet export consumes excessive memory or crashes on large workbooks, first confirm the row count and attach the export job log to the ticket. These cases are owned by the Ledgerworks performance squad, who ask that all reports be sent to them directly.

escalation mailbox, bafog-fafog: ulador@paliqlabs.internal

# Migration notes for new contractors:
# We replaced the homegrown Cartwheel job queue with Drayline in
# release 7.0. Old CARTWHEEL_* keys are dead and should never be
# reintroduced. Drayline workers poll the broker directly, which
# requires an authenticated connection from every worker process.
# The broker credential must appear on the very next line.

vault entry, yahif-yajep: COURIER_KEY29=b802bdf8034096b65a51c6ba5abe2